#d7e91c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7e91c is composed of 84.3% red, 91.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 88%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 65.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 51.2%. #d7e91c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#afd300.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#d7e91c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7e91c has RGB values of R:215, G:233,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.88,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 14149916.

Shades and Tints of #d7e91c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050501 is the darkest color, while #fdfef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7e91c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88897c is the less saturated color, while #e7fc09 is the most saturated one.
